    Requirements

    • Mastery of the e-commerce marketing funnel from offer to ad to landing page to conversion.
    • 7+ years minimum of paid media advertising experience within Paid Social, specifically Meta, building high converting funnels and driving quantifiable results.
    • 5+ years minimum managing paid social advertising for growing clients in the consumer space with over $400k+ minimum monthly aggregate spend.
    • Expertise in developing, testing, and optimizing advertisement copy and short form video creative.
    • Expertise in creative consultation for successful Paid Social Ads that convert.
    • Background in data-derived decision-making and forecasting budgets/spend projections linked to perceived results.
    • Experience with core e-commerce revenue drivers and reporting on key metrics (CPA, CAC, iROAS, aMER, TSR, CTR, Hold Rate).

    What You'll Do

    • Plan, develop, and implement comprehensive paid media strategies primarily focused on Paid Social to increase brand visibility and recognition and drive new user acquisition and leads via paid media campaigns.
    • Conduct thorough brand and website audits to understand clients’ key value propositions, core products, and brand aesthetics and identify opportunities to market them successfully.
    • Focus on short form creative and direct response creative to convert customers and guide clients on advertising spend behind winning creatives.
    • Conduct competitive research to ensure success in the ad space and new acquisition audience targeting.
    • Manage 5-10 Paid Media accounts on behalf of clients, with aggregate monthly spends ranging between $80,000 - $3M.
    • Utilize Platform Ad Managers, third-party reporting tools, and AI to develop insights and action items to increase clients’ revenues month-over-month and solve for attribution.
    • Master important KPIs like CPA, CAC, iROAS, nCAC, MER, aMER, CTR, TSR, and Hold Rate.
    • Understand industry-wide benchmarks throughout all steps in the e-commerce marketing funnel.
    • Implement real-time, proactive, and reactionary ad-buying decisions across multiple platforms in response to trends on ads platforms.
    • Develop quarterly strategies for clientele based on success metrics, ad spends, YoY performance metrics, and projections.
    • Deep dive into competitor research, industry knowledge, and brand identity to manage client expectations and brainstorm new marketing initiatives, creative assets, and copy.
    • Understand full-funnel marketing strategies to ensure healthy new customer acquisition within the broader e-commerce equation.
    • Deliver projections and forecasts that inform client quarterly strategy.
    • Learn and understand e-commerce P&Ls and engage with financial metrics.
